US Ambassador Ends Her Four Year In Costa Rica This Week

Friday will the last day as the first woman to serve as U.S. Ambassador to Costa Rica, Anne Andrew, says goodbye to her team she has led since December 2009. But it won’t be goodbye to Costa Rica entirely.

amb_andrew_ver2_500x333Married, with two teenage kids who just recently received their High School diploma in Costa Rica, Andrew says she will return to the private sector in the United Syayes after leaving the State Department. He connection to Costa Rica will remain a member of the board of director of EARTH University.

In a Twitter post Andrews says of her children, “attending High School here has enriched their lives in many ways”.

During Ambassador Andrew’s tenure in Costa Rica, she has had the opportunity to leverage her expertise acquired in a career that has spanned the fields of law, business, and public policy. Immediately before becoming Ambassador, she was a founder of New Energy Nexus, LLC a consulting firm advising companies and investors on strategies related to clean energy technology.

U.S. President Barack Obama has not yet named her successor.
